Choosing the Right Online College for Accounting and Business (H2 Heading)

When looking for the best online college to pursue your degree in accounting or business, several factors come into play. Accreditation is paramount; choosing an accredited institution ensures that the quality of education meets industry standards. Programs from accredited colleges also tend to be more respected by potential employers, making your degree more valuable.

Moreover, flexibility in course offerings is vital. Many online colleges offer asynchronous classes, allowing students to learn at their own pace, a necessary feature for those balancing work or family commitments. Reviewing faculty credentials, technology used for online learning, and available student support services can also make a significant difference in your educational experience.

Investing in Your Future: Tuition and Financial Aid Options (H2 Heading)

Investing in education is a significant decision that requires careful consideration of tuition costs and financial aid options. Most online colleges provide competitive tuition rates, making higher education more accessible. For instance, the University of Massachusetts offers various affordable programs while ensuring financial aid opportunities are readily available.

Moreover, potential students should explore scholarship opportunities, as many institutions have distinctive scholarships for aspiring accountants and business leaders. These can drastically reduce tuition costs and make it easier for students to focus on their studies rather than financial burdens. Websites like Fastweb and the College Board can help students find suitable scholarships tailored to their fields of study.

Also, Federal Financial Aid is available for eligible students. Filling out the FAFSA (Free Application for Federal Student Aid) can unlock federal grants, loans, and work-study opportunities to ease the financial load associated with tuition and fees.

Preparing for Certification in Accounting (H2 Heading)

For aspiring accountants, preparing for certification is a pivotal part of the educational journey. Many accredited online accounting programs align their coursework with the requirements of the CPA (Certified Public Accountant) exam, ensuring students are prepared to meet the standards necessary for certification. Institutions such as Liberty University offer CPA exam prep courses, significantly enhancing students’ chances of passing the certification process.

Additionally, understanding the differences between various accounting certifications, such as CMA (Certified Management Accountant) and CIA (Certified Internal Auditor), is crucial. Different career paths may require specific certifications, and collaborating with academic advisors about these requirements can provide clarity to aspiring professionals.

Lastly, some programs focus on promoting professional development through workshops and seminars that guide students in studying for their certifications. This emphasis on certification preparation underscores the commitment of top online colleges to ensuring their graduates are career-ready.
